Pan-Seared Cod with Lemon Garlic Butter

A simple yet flavorful pan-seared cod dish featuring a zesty lemon garlic butter sauce. Perfect for a light and healthy main course.

Main Dish
Easy 20 min 280 cal
Steps

1. Pat the cod fillet dry and season both sides with salt and pepper. 2. Heat ol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at. 3. Place the cod in the skillet and cook for 3-4 minutes on each side until golden and cooked through. 4. Remove cod from skillet and set aside. 5. In the same skillet, reduce heat to medium and add butter and minced garlic. 6. Cook garlic for about 1 minute until fragrant but not browned. 7. Add lemon juice and stir to combine. 8. Pour the lemon garlic butter sauce over the cod. 9. Garnish with fresh parsley and serve immediately.

Ingredients

150g cod fillet 1 tbsp olive oil 1 tbsp unsalted butter 1 garlic clove, minced Juice of 1/2 lemon Salt and pepper to taste Fresh parsley for garnish
